PUC § 335 Effective Jan 1, 2002Div. 1 · Part 1 · Ch. 2.3 · Art. 2
In order to ensure that the interests of the people of California are served, a five-member Electricity Oversight Board is hereby created as provided in Section 336. For purposes of this chapter, any reference to the Oversight Board shall mean the Electricity Oversight Board. Its functions shall be all of the following:
(a)To oversee the Independent System Operator and the Power Exchange.
(b)To determine the composition and terms of service and to exercise the exclusive right to decline to confirm the appointments of specific members of the governing board of the Power Exchange.

Legislative history

Amended by Stats. 2001, Ch. 766, Sec. 1. Also amended, in identical language, by Stats. 2001, 2nd Ex. Sess., Ch. 16, effective August 8, 2002. Effective January 1, 2002.
